On days when Gerrit Cole doesn't pitch, Yankees are in trouble

The Yankees have one starting pitcher. OK, one-and-a-half. The Yankees’ decision to let Masahiro Tanaka walk and not sign any free-agent starting pitchers other than Corey Kluber, who had barely pitched over the last two seasons, and trade for Jameson Taillon, who had also barely pitched over the last two seasons, was questioned all offseason. We’re seeing why. The offense has been abysmal, but the rotation is a problem that might not be resolved this season.
